Summit’s Team Is Inspired To Touch And Help Change Lives Through Summit’s Clinical Studies In The Field Of Oncology. Summit Has Multiple Global Phase 3 Clinical Studies, Including
Non-small Cell Lung Cancer (NSCLC)- HARMONi:
Phase 3 clinical study which was intended to evaluate ivonescimab combined with chemotherapy compared to placebo plus chemotherapy in patients with EGFR-mutated, locally advanced or metastatic non-squamous NSCLC who were previously treated with a 3rd generation EGFR TKI. - HARMONi-3:
Phase 3 clinical study which is intended to evaluate ivonescimab combined with chemotherapy compared to pembrolizumab combined with chemotherapy in patients with first-line metastatic NSCLC. - HARMONi-7:
Phase 3 clinical study which is intended to evaluate ivonescimab monotherapy compared to pembrolizumab monotherapy in patients with first-line metastatic NSCLC.
- HARMONi-GI3:
Phase 3 clinical study intended to evaluate ivonescimab in combination with chemotherapy compared with bevacizumab plus chemotherapy.
Ivonescimab is an investigational therapy not presently approved by any regulatory authority other than China’s National Medical Products Administration (NMPA). Summit is headquartered in Miami, Florida, and has additional offices in California, New Jersey, the UK, and Ireland.
Overview Of RoleThe Manager/Senior Manager, Downstream MSAT, is an experienced and enthusiastic process engineer who will join a dynamic late-stage clinical and commercial environment working with our lead asset, Ivonescimab. The ideal candidate will have proven technical ability in overall downstream production of biologics. The role involves working with the Summit MSAT group and other CMC, quality, and regulatory stakeholders in drug substance to provide operational and technical oversight on all downstream-related activities across the organization to achieve Summit milestones.
This position will require building operational relationships with Summit CDMOs and working in close collaboration internally and externally to ensure successful CMC deliverables.
- Contribute to and have accountability for all Summit Downstream CMC activities, focusing on control strategy development, process validation, continued process verification, and technical troubleshooting to support drug substance and product (as needed)
- Support phase-appropriate downstream process development, characterization, validation, and technology transfers to or between external CDMOs for drug substance (DS).
- Assess and manage process risks arising from manufacturing or process changes.
- Develop effective working relationships with Summit project team members and external Contract Manufacturing Organizations (CMOs).
- Assist in the authorship, update, and/or review of regulatory filings.
- Support MSAT team objectives while providing clear and concise updates of results and reports to the project team leaders, including the Head of CMC.
- Work in close partnership with process scientists & engineers, QA, RA, supply chain, consultants, and cross-functionally.
- Support CMC sub-teams and programs.
- Facilitate problem-solving, contingency planning, and decision-making.
- Provide technical support to manufacturing operations, addressing and resolving any issues that arise during downstream processing.
- Drive continuous improvement to enhance process robustness, efficiency, and scalability.
- Oversee tech transfer activities to ensure a seamless transition from development to manufacturing.
